Recipes from The Inglenook Cookbook
 by The Sisters of the Brethren Church (1906)

PRESERVING AND CANNING

CANNING CUCUMBERS
 
 
 Wash the cucumbers, place in a kettle and cover with cider vinegar. Add 3 large tablespoonfuls of sugar, mixed spices, peppers, and to each can of cucumbers add 8 onion sets. Heat gradually till hot through. Fill the cans with cucumbers, then heat the vinegar to a boil and fill up the can. Seal at once.

Sister Mollie Conway, Bradford, Ohio.
